Crémant Cream of the Crop
Wines included
Crémant d'Alsace Cuvée Julien, Dopff au Moulin NV
Traditional method fizz from a house that specialises in Crémant, in the classic Alsace mix of pinot blanc and auxerrois. It's delicate, easy-drinking yellow-plum and apple fruit are given extra depth by longer bottle maturation. A delicious start to any meal or counterpoint to smoked fish dishes.
Crémant du Jura Brut Zero, Domaine de Montbourgeau NV
From Jura in the east of France comes this delightful bone-dry chardonnay. No additional sugar is added and yet it's so deliciously easy to drink, rounded and balanced.
Crémant de Die Brut, Cave Poulet
Perfect aperitif-style sparkler from the Drôme Valley in south-eastern France, made from a blend of local clairette, aligoté and muscat. Dry, fruity, delicate, refreshing and a great start to the weekend.
The Society's Celebration Crémant de Loire 2023
This elegant, refined sparkling wine is made for The Wine Society by Gratien & Meyer, purveyors of Society-label fizz for more than a century. It comes from the Saumur region of the Loire and uses a large percentage of chardonnay in the blend, which gives the wine its length and delicacy. Light, bone-dry and refreshing, it makes for a delightful aperitif. The jester's hat on the label is a throwback to the image that adorned this wine when it was first introduced as part of a celebration range marking 25 years of The Society in Stevenage.
Crémant de Limoux Cuvée Eugénie, Antech 2023
An elegant, refined dry sparkler from the Languedoc, where the first sparkling wines were made in 1531. Chardonnay and chenin dominate the blend, and there is a lovely stream of bubbles to seduce and enliven the palate.
